It is possible to change the audio soundtrack language to a different language from the one selected at the initial settings (This operation works only with discs on which multiple audio soundtrack languages are recorded). Press AUDIO button during playing DVD disc, the screen will display the number of current soundtrack language, press the button again will change the language. NOTE: When no soundtrack languages are recorded, press this button will not work. NOTE: When the power is turned on or the disc is removed, the language heard is the one selected at the initial settings. Some DVDs may contain scenes which have been shot simultaneously from a number of different angles. For these discs, the same scene can be views from each of these different angles using the ANGLE button. Press ANGLE during play, number of angle being playback will be displayed in the screen, press the button will change to different angles. Press SEARCH button during play, then press up or down navigation button to select Title, Chapter, Title time or Chapter time to play. Enter the Title, Chapter, Title time or Chapter time to play by using the numeric buttons. [. . . ] ) (If you wipe the discs using a circular motion, circular scratches are likely to occur, which will cause noise. ) If the disc is brought from a cold to a warm environment moisture may form on the disc Wipe this moisture off with a soft, dry, lint-free cloth before using the disc. Improper disc storage You can damage discs if you store them in the following places: Areas exposed to direct sunlight Humid or dusty areas Areas directly exposed to a heat outlet or heating appliance Be sure to press POWER to set the player to the standby mode and disconnect the AC power cord before maintaining the player. If the surfaces are extremely dirty , wipe clean with a cloth which has been dipped in a weak soap-and-water solution and wrung out thoroughly, and then wipe again with a dry cloth. [. . . ]
